Best High Schools in Haywood County, NC

Haywood County, NC has 8 high schools with 3,194 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Haywood County score 57%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 46%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Haywood County greatly ex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Haywood County, NC

County-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Haywood County, NC has a total population of 62,089 with 18%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 92%, and 29%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
